Rear end issue front passenger driver spins freely makes metallic clanking and attempts to spin the shaft between rear ends but can't all other drive wheels spin this shaft? What can the cause be
-
the other shafts will spin that shaft becuase it doesnt take much effort with that shaft being shot. but with that shaft being that it is shot doesnt have enough teeth depth to spin over the other wheels. Pull the driveshaft and inspect the splines. Its only a few bolts. If those splines check out, your gonna have to get the reaer rebuilt
